المعنى وراء كلمة: Containerize

يشير مصطلح containerize إلى عملية تعبئة تطبيق أو مكوناته في وحدة موحدة تسمى الحاوية. تسهل هذه الطريقة النشر المتسق وقابلية التوسع وإدارة البرامج عبر بيئات مختلفة.

عبارات وأمثلة

  • تطبيقات Containerize: ممارسة تغليف تطبيقات البرمجيات داخل حاويات لضمان الأداء الموحد وسهولة النشر عبر منصات مختلفة.
  • خدمات الحاويات: تتضمن عزل الخدمات المصغرة داخل حاويات منفصلة لتعزيز قابلية التوسع والقدرة على الصيانة في نظام موزع.
  • وضع الكود في حاويات: عملية وضع الكود في حاويات لتبسيط التطوير والاختبار من خلال توفير بيئات معزولة ومتسقة.
  • حاويات البنية الأساسية: يشير إلى نهج نشر مكونات البنية الأساسية كحاويات لتحسين كفاءة الموارد وإمكانية إدارتها.

الاستخدام والأهمية

لقد أحدث مفهوم containerize ثورة في طريقة تطوير البرامج ونشرها. فمن خلال تغليف التطبيقات وتبعياتها في حاويات، فإنه يضمن تشغيلها بشكل متسق بغض النظر عن النظام الأساسي. وهذه الممارسة جزء لا يتجزأ من استراتيجيات DevOps والحوسبة السحابية الحديثة، مما يتيح حلولاً برمجية فعالة وقابلة للتطوير.

خاتمة

أصبحت ممارسة containerize حجر الزاوية في تطوير البرمجيات الحديثة ونشرها. من خلال عزل التطبيقات وتبعياتها داخل الحاويات، فإنها تضمن الاتساق وقابلية التوسع والكفاءة عبر بيئات متنوعة. يعمل هذا النهج على تبسيط الإدارة وتعزيز قابلية النقل ودعم التكامل السلس للتطبيقات في البنى التحتية المختلفة، مما يجعلها مكونًا رئيسيًا لاستراتيجيات التكنولوجيا المعاصرة.